Transaction 174c9875cb1441e084f7142ca894f8b2351591939adb33a733c21c548fb606aa
1 Input
1 Output
-
174c9875cb1441e084f7142ca894f8b2351591939adb33a733c21c548fb606aa:0
- value
- 50584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70b163a8f009dad5071f5a7d88562d1c67c322b4 OP_EQUAL
- address
- 3Bxt7Fdt9gYHD4WucvX8yP25kfwgPPdrR6